Construction Cost Overview for Ironton, OH

Construction and renovation costs in Ironton, OH reflect the city's cost of living index of 83.4 and a material cost index of 83 (where 100 represents the national baseline). With an average construction labor rate of $37.67 per hour and a median home price of $146,000, homeowners in Ironton should plan their renovation budgets carefully using local pricing data.

Ironton sits in IECC Climate Zone 5 (Cool-Humid), which influences insulation requirements, HVAC sizing, and overall material choices for both new construction and remodeling projects. Low seismic risk — standard building codes apply. The median household income of $54,100 in Ironton means that a mid-range kitchen remodel at $42,011 represents approximately 78% of annual household income.

Building permits in Ironton average $971, varying by project scope and local building department requirements. Major renovations involving structural, electrical, or plumbing work require permits in virtually all Ohio jurisdictions. Scheduling projects during off-peak seasons can save 5-15% on labor costs as contractors have greater availability.

Do I need a building permit for home renovations in Ironton?
Most significant renovations in Ironton, OH require building permits. Permit costs average around $971 depending on project scope. Projects involving structural changes, electrical rewiring, plumbing modifications, or additions almost always require permits. Cosmetic updates like interior painting, replacing fixtures, or installing new flooring typically do not.
